WebMar 21, 2024 · Urine ethanol is a common finding in urine drug-screening results. An unexpected finding of alcohol in urine can have serious implications for patients who have committed to pain-management contracts or are being counseled for substance abuse.

WebMay 3, 2024 · The purpose of urine drug testing is to verify adherence to prescribed medications, identify undisclosed drugs, and discourage drug misuse, abuse, and diversion. The actual use of urine drug tests as part of adherence monitoring has been associated with a 49% reduction in opioid abuse according to a publication by Manchikanti.

WebAn adulterant product may be added with the intention of adversely affecting the testing reagents. Dilution-Result of ingestion of large amounts of water typically just before urine donation or as a result of physiological conditions.
